Sr. Producer (The Jim Rome Show/CBS Sports Radio)
Overview

This position is a highly coveted one within the media industry. Jim Rome hosts a self-titled weekday radio and television program simulcast heard on more than 200 radio stations and seen on the CBS Sports Network and via a widespread digital presence online and in social media. The Senior Producer collaborates with Jim Rome each day to produce and create a three-hour radio program, coordinating and preparing for the appearances of high-profile athletes, coaches and league officials. Additionally, this role allows for daily content collaboration with Jim Rome, providing declarative observations on the world of sports and the culture that surrounds this significant part of the American landscape. Those contributions include writing well-researched and defined observations in the voice
of the program. They are shared with the audience by the host of the program and heard by millions of listeners and viewers in America each day.

The Jim Rome Show is the longest running sports talk radio program in syndication. It's regarded within the industry as a pioneering effort in solo hosting a daily conversation with the audience. Today's radio program hosted by Jim Rome includes not only the audience relationship via radio and an accompanying podcast, but also a social media presence and regular appearances on other programs. There are opportunities to travel with Jim Rome for Super Bowl, Final Four and other high-profile appearances, providing producing counsel.

Responsibilities

What You'll Do:

The qualified individual for this position should have a minimum several years of everyday writing cadence as a regular course of professional habit. He or she should possess a superior knowledge of both the professional major sports as well as collegiate sports. Experience in a collaborative writing environment is a very helpful work experience trait. Writing in a first person, expression filled descriptive language manner that echoes the tone of the program and the relationship that exists between the host and his audience is also most helpful. Experience

in producing radio programming is highly preferred, but not necessary. Understanding the nuances of a live audience relationship, the coordination of interviews for timely input, manufacturing a certain energy that attracts and holds a large audience and properly preparing all participants involved in the creation of a radio program known to perform at this audience and affiliate size is extraordinarily helpful.

The Senior Producer will be working in a radio and television studio environment with half a dozen other individuals, in a specially built out broadcast facility in Irvine, CA. The workday starts early at 6am and continues through a daily 9am to Noon PT zone broadcast, with subsequent follow up duties planning for the next days' broadcasts. There is frequent collaboration in the weeknight evenings, in the preparation of interviews and breaking news in the world of sports. The individual should have the interest and time to observe live sports broadcasts, so as to witness the events that many of our listeners do, as well as maintain a high intake of information received through other broadcasts and social media.
